The Essentials of Metal Polishing - Usually, metal polishing is wanted for appearance or clean-room application. It's one of the most popular techniques for its utility in intensifying the overall beauty of the items, such as, motorcycle parts, motor vehicle parts or cookware. In addition, many clean-rooms want a shiny finish in order to lessen the permeability of the components which often can result in dust to collect and contaminate. An outstanding illustration of this implementation might be in a vacuum chamber.

There exist a great many different ways to polish metal, and let us check out some of the steps required. Various metals can be finished electromechanically, chemically, manually, or with purpose built buffing machines. A particular finishing paste or compound is regularly utilized, which will include aluminum oxide, limestone, chromium oxide, tripoli, chalk, dolomite,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, because of its weak thermal conductivity, relatively high viscidness, and hardness is usually one of the most time intensive. Conversely, merchandise constructed from non-ferrous metal are much more amenable to finishing, because these demand the minimum amount of processes.

A lesser pad speed is used when a superior quality mirror finish is requested. Finishing buffs smothered with paste are appreciably affected by specific pressure on the surface of the buffing pad. The level of the pressure on the surface can be accelerated to a specific range, having said that, surpassing the most effective level of force not simply decreases the quality level of treatment, but also worsens performance, could cause wear on the part, plus there is also an evident heating of the pieces being worked on, an outcome of friction. When you are working on thinner items, it will be raised heat (and the subsequent flexibility of the material) that will probably cause items to warp, distort, or bend. Normally, it will take a highly skilled polisher to take into account every one of these elements to both prevent damage to the metal part and to perform the job competently. In order to appreciably boost the standard of the resultant surface, the finishing procedure should really be implemented with significantly less power and not a large amount of pressure so that you can eventually produce a surface with no scratches or marks caused by the buffing process, subsequently ending up with a beautiful mirror finish.
